About me
I don't necessarily **love** to cook, but I do enjoy it. I'm 43 & love traveling, photography, & reading. I was born'n'raised in southern West Virginia & have lived in CA's San Fernando Valley, Detroit MI, & Columbus OH. Due to my mom's ill health, I have recently returned to my home state to care for her. Having lived in three bigger cities since I was 19, it's a strange kind of culture shock being back in WV again, but home is home no matter what, right?!! LOL - Being a healthy southern soul food foodie simply means that I "reconstruct" some of the recipes that I grew up with...I season my beans & greens with smoked turkey legs and/or wings instead of ham hocks or smoked pork neck bones (I don't eat pork 'cuz it really does cause swelling..at least for me anyway!), and I use very little salt (if any) when cooking (I tell folks right off to season it at the table to their own liking..AFTER they've eaten half of it!)
